Dear maintainer(s),

With a recent upload of m2crypto the autopkgtest of m2crypto fails in
testing when that autopkgtest is run with the binary packages of
m2crypto from unstable. It passes when run with only packages from
testing. In tabular form:

                       pass            fail
m2crypto               from testing    0.38.0-1
all others             from testing    from testing

I copied some of the output at the bottom of this report.

Currently this regression is blocking the migration to testing [1]. Can
you please investigate the situation and fix it?
